Thank holy God in heaven! As a nerd you wish certain things would happen that will make your nerdiness seem worthwhile and today is one of those days. Zack Snyder has been tapped by Christopher “the godfather” Nolan to direct Superman: The Man of Steel.

When it was announced that Snyder was on the short list of directors I was readily excited but still kept my reserve thinking the job would go to someone else. Nolan must have seen what I have in Snyder’s work. A love for the material he directs and an attention to detail that is almost unmatched except, possibly, by Nolan himself. Snyder is no stranger to the superhero flick already having the excellent Watchmen under his belt. Now he can add the apex of superheros to the mix.

Now the only question is who will Nolan, Snyder and company pick as their new Man of Steel. I would hope Brandon Routh would at least be given a chance to come back but I realize this is a reboot and it will be a fresh face.

Superman: The Man of Steel is targeted for a holiday 2012 release.
